Tool & Die Apprentice
We are seeking a well-organized, action oriented, and disciplined Tool & Die Apprentice (TDA) who is looking to grow their expertise in the tool making trade. This position will collaboratively work with experienced tool and die makers to gain hands on knowledge of the die making trade.
The Tool & Die Apprentice supports the toolroom by assisting with the maintenance, repair, and build of stamping dies under the guidance of experienced toolmakers. This role is designed for individuals looking to develop a career in tool & die within a manufacturing environment and includes hands-on training in die maintenance, machining, and troubleshooting.
This job requires the ability to complete many different tasks with a meticulous approach to produce accurate results and adhere to quality standards. A high level of expertise is expected and the ability to follow procedures while multitasking to uphold quality standards is required to be successful in this role.
Reports To: Production Manager
Key Responsibilities
•Assist in the maintenance, repair, and setup of stamping dies (progressive and/or transfer).
•Support troubleshooting of die issues affecting part quality or press performance.
•Help disassemble, clean, inspect, and reassemble dies.
•Perform basic machining operations (drill press, grinder, mill, lathe) under supervision.
•Assist with die changes and press setup as trained.
•Measure and inspect components using basic measuring tools (calipers, micrometers, indicators).
•Maintain toolroom organization and follow 5S practices.
•Follow all safety procedures, including lockout/tagout.
•Document work performed and communicate issues to senior toolmakers.
•Participate in on-the-job training and formal apprenticeship coursework if applicable.
